Career path

Career Role (Prosthetic Limb Development) Description
Prosthetist/Orthotist Designs, fits, and adjusts prosthetic limbs; assesses patient needs and provides ongoing care. High demand, excellent job prospects.
Biomedical Engineer (Prosthetics) Develops and improves prosthetic limb technology; researches new materials and designs. Growing field with strong salary potential.
Prosthetic Technician Fabricates and repairs prosthetic components; works closely with prosthetists and engineers. Essential role in prosthetic limb development.
Clinical Scientist (Prosthetics) Conducts research on prosthetic limb technology; evaluates the effectiveness of new technologies. Excellent career progression opportunities.
3D Printing Specialist (Prosthetics) Utilizes 3D printing technology to create custom prosthetic components; key role in personalized prosthetic care. Emerging and in-demand skill.
